摘要
A novel angular independent dual-band FSS with closely spaced response is discussed in this letter. The proposed single layer FSS comprises of unit cell resembling crooked cross geometry convoluted and branched to provide dual resonant paths. The FSS functioning as a band stop filter at 2.54 and 3.54 GHz works as a shielding component for S band operation. The unit cell size of the proposed FSS is where corresponds to the wavelength of the first resonant frequency. Both the bands are closely spaced providing the frequency ratio of upper to the lower resonant frequency value of 1.39. Additionally, the proposed dual-band FSS is symmetrical in nature, thereby providing identical stop-band response for both TE and TM operation modes. It also exhibits highly stable angular stability. Prototype of the proposed FSS is fabricated and its simulated results are compared with the experimental results.
